## Configuration

Purgatory, our retention sweeper, reads everything from a single env file — no YAML, no surprises. Set the retention window in days, the batch size (keep it under 500 unless you enjoy lock contention), and the dry-run flag, which you should leave on for the first release candidate. Schedules are cron-style and evaluated in UTC. One more thing before you cut the release: the sweeper needs its archive-store credential, so put that on the following line.

vault entry, yahif-yajep: COURIER_KEY29=b802bdf8034096b65a51c6ba5abe2

## Timezone gotchas in exports

Quick note for reviewers: Bramblewick exports always normalize to UTC, then apply the viewer's offset at render time. Don't trust the legacy `local_ts` column — it's a trap. The exporter needs an API credential to fetch offset tables, so in the exporter's env file, add the secret on the next line.

sealed setting: VAULT_KEY13=741e0a90de233

### Vendoring fonts for Brindlecast

Quick reminder for the sync: we no longer pull the Hexalight font family from the upstream CDN at build time. After the checksum mismatch scare, all third-party fonts get vendored into the `assets/vendored` tree and pinned by hash. Run `make fonts-sync` after bumping a version, then eyeball the diff — licensing files must come along for the ride. The fetcher reads its source mirrors and pinning rules from the service config, shown below.

settings of kagag-kagef:
[kelath]
port = 9300
region = west-4
host = kelath.olvarqworks.example
team = sorion
timeout_ms = 1000
retries = 8

Plugin authors publishing rules to the DocSweep linter have reported 401 errors since Monday. The cause is the scheduled expiry of the shared registry token; it was not rotated before the cutoff. A replacement has been issued and validated against the staging registry by the Marblewick platform team. Update your publish configuration before your next release; the old token will be rejected permanently after Friday. Use the following key for all registry calls going forward.

API key for yagef-bagef: zpat23_RTEspBOEmE9eDRK8oFjwnRE